An Early Prospective Study of the Traq™ Device for Characterization of Binocular Ocular Function in Normal Subjects and Subjects With Recent Traumatic Brain Injury (REB-001)

July 30, 2026 updated by: Rebiscan, Inc.
The early prospective study of Traq™ (an investigational binocular ophthalmic neurodiagnostic device) will measure binocular ocular functions (bilateral foveal fixation, foveal binocularity, and fovea-tracked saccadic latency) in normal subjects and those with history of mild-to moderate traumatic brain injury (mTBI).

Study Overview

Detailed Description

An initial, single-center, prospective, non-masked, non-randomized, parallel-arm clinical study designed to collect Traq™ measurement data from normal subjects (normal arm) and subjects with a history of mild to moderate traumatic brain injury (mTBI) within the last six months (post-TBI arm) to characterize binocular ocular function measurement outcomes across the two study populations.

Inclusion Criteria:

  1. Age 12 years or older at the time of enrollment.
  2. Able to understand and sign an informed consent form (or with parent/guardian for subjects less than 18 years of age).
  3. Willing and able to complete all required study visits and test assessments.
  4. Subjects with no history of traumatic brain injury (normal arm).
  5. Subjects with a history of mild to moderate traumatic brain injury (mTBI) within the last six months, (post-TBI arm).

Exclusion Criteria:

  1. Concurrent participation in another drug or device clinical investigation.
  2. Subject with a history of eye disease which could reduce, or limit reflected polarized light from the retina, such as corneal scarring, cataract, glaucoma, degenerative retinal conditions (e.g., age-related macular degeneration, diabetic retinopathy), or other conditions which may decrease device signal reflectance.
  3. Subjects who are pregnant, planning to become pregnant, or are breastfeeding.

Device Metrics
Time Frame: Four individual scans through study completion: Day 0, Day 30, Day 60, Day 90.

A composite Traq score will be calculated on a scale of 0.00-to-2.00 at each visit. The score will be a calculated combination of the following, additional outcome measures:

  • Bilateral foveal fixation
  • Foveal binocularity
  • Fovea-tracked saccadic latency

Device Metrics
Time Frame: Four individual scans through study completion: Day 0, Day 30, Day 60, Day 90.
Bilateral foveal fixation will be measured as a percentage (from 0.00-1.00%) of time in which both eyes fixate together during the scan.

Foveal fixation
Time Frame: Four individual scans through study completion: Day 0, Day 30, Day 60, Day 90.
The device will capture each individual eye's ability to fixate as a percentage (from 0.00 to 1.00) of time during the scan. A result will be provided for each individual eye.

Device outputs
Time Frame: Four individual scans through study completion: Day 0, Day 30, Day 60, Day 90.
Fovea-tracked saccadic latency will be calculated in milliseconds to measure when fixation is attained and lost throughout the scan.
